Is the design of the character I present myself as relevant to my art? Not really XD I'm not even using it right now, I have Cyn as my icon at the moment.
Is it fun to do? Absolutely. Should I have the freedom to change it's design as many times as I want? Yes. Do I wish I had the final design sooner so people would get used to related it to me sooner? Also yes XD But part of being an artist is getting used to chances.
Do what feels right in the moment, but don't block yourself from the idea of evolving a concept. External criticism is great for your growth, but you also have the right to be critical of your own art.
Just don't be extremely hard on negative on yourself. Try thinking: Wow, this is good. But I bet I can make it great! Everything can be improved. Is not a 'oh, no. I did it this way and there's no going back and make it better.'
